Hi all. I'd like to create a dir into the buildroot PATH by using the output of a variable. Let me explain. Imagine something like: perl=`rpm -q --queryformat='%{VERSION}' perl` Then: echo $perl 5.8.8 So the point really is, I'd like to do something like: mkdir -p $RPM_BUILD_ROOT/`echo $perl` In orded to create the directory, calling it as the perl version installed in the system.
